The Rise of Whale Activity in Ethereum
According to blockchain analytics firm Santiment, whales and sharks (wallets holding substantial amounts of Ethereum) have accumulated approximately 934,240 ETH over the last three weeks. With this figure translating to an estimated value of $3.15 billion, it’s clear that institutional investors and high-net-worth individuals are bullish on Ethereum’s future.
The accumulation has contributed to Ethereum reclaiming critical resistance levels, including the $3,250 price point, which has now transformed into a support zone. Observers are optimistic that the crypto could soon challenge the $3,400 level, a key target for traders looking for either breakout opportunities or retracements.
Retail Investors Take a Different Route
While whales are accumulating Ethereum, smaller retail investors appear to be offloading their holdings. A reported 1,041 ETH has been sold by retail wallets during the past week, suggesting a divide in market behavior between long-term holders and short-term traders. This divergence may reflect risk aversion among smaller investors amidst macroeconomic uncertainty.
Key Price Levels to Watch
Market analysts have pinpointed several critical levels to monitor over the coming weeks:
- $3,250 Support Zone: This reclaimed level is now a stronghold for Ethereum and could serve as a foundation for further growth.
- $3,400 Resistance: A potential area to watch for trading rejections or breakouts.
- $3,150 Zone: Analysts suggest this level could provide new long-entry opportunities if a market pullback occurs.
These levels are particularly vital for traders implementing both long and short positions in Ethereum.
